    The design is a four-cylinder, two-stroke, piston diesel engine, in an inverted-V configuration, with turbocharging and supercharging, mechanical fuel injection, liquid cooling, direct drive.     DeltaHawk Engines, Inc. is an American aircraft engine manufacturer. The company builds Diesel and Jet-A-fuelled engines for general aviation aircraft. [1]DeltaHawk engines have been tested in a Velocity RG homebuilt aircraft, an Australian Delta D2 helicopter and retrofitted in a Cirrus SR20 certified aircraft. [2]

    [29] [30] A water-cooled DeltaHawk engine has been successfully fitted to a Rotorway helicopter, weighing the same as an air-cooled petrol engine of similar power and being capable of maintaining that power to 17,000 feet. [31] The 180 hp DeltaHawk DH180 received its FAA Type certification in May 2023, first deliveries are planned in 2024. [32]
